- [ ] **Step 7: Breaker override escrow.** After sealing the signing keys for the Tallgrove upstream API circuit breaker, confirm the support team can force the breaker open during a full outage. The override bundle lives in the sealed escrow drawer and is useless without its unlock phrase. Two ceremony witnesses must initial this step before proceeding. The escrow bundle is decrypted with the recovery passphrase that follows.

vault phrase of kahip-kahop = holath-quenmir

Subject: Query planner regression — heads up before Thursday's cut

Hey release folks,

Quick note for the weekly sync: the Lumenquery planner started picking nested-loop joins on mid-size tables after the costing change in sprint 41. Marisol bisected it to the stats sampler tweak, and we've got a revert staged. Queries on the Fenwick cluster were 4–6x slower, so let's hold the train until it lands. The fixed build is below.

session token of yajof-bagef = htk4_937d

Ticket #— Floor 9 Opening Prep, Brindlemoor House

Hi facilities folks, Floor 9 opens to staff next Monday and we need a few things squared away before then. Lift access is live, but the two side doors by the kitchenette are still on the old lock config — please reprogram them before Friday. Also, signage for the quiet rooms hasn't arrived, so pop up the temporary printed ones for now. Until the badge readers sync, the interim door code for Floor 9 is below.

door code, bajop-bajog: bdg-DSWAC-43621